“I was pushing through the agonizing pain of childbirth, trusting my best friend Sienna as she fed me a warm bowl of herbal broth. But as the sweet liquid slid down my throat, a paralyzing numbness took over, and her gentle smile twisted into a triumphant smirk. "Your father and brothers are already dead," she whispered, as the sickening crunch of bone echoed outside my window. My fated mate, Donavan, had slaughtered my entire family. He didn't even bother to come into the room, telling Sienna that watching a wolfless thing like me die would be too messy. Using my last ounce of strength, I delivered my newborn daughter, only to watch Sienna order the midwife to throw my baby away like trash. Donavan finally walked in, perfectly groomed despite the massacre, and Sienna threw herself into his arms, faking heartbroken sobs over my tragic death in labor. As my life drained away into a cold, dark sea, pure hatred burned through my soul. Why did my fated mate and my best friend do this to me? I had given them my absolute trust, only to be discarded while they built their future on my family's blood. With my final breath, I stared into his treacherous eyes and made a silent vow that if I ever had another chance, I would make them pay. Opening my eyes again, the phantom pain vanished, and warm sunlight hit my face. I was back in my childhood bedroom, exactly five years ago, on the morning of my Mating Ceremony with Donavan.”
